Monoprice's SlimRun™ Cat6A is a small cable with big performance. With a cable diameter of almost half a standard Cat6A cable, SlimRun Cat6A is easier to route and saves valuable space in high density environments, such as data centers and telecommunications rooms. With SlimRun Cat6A, you can fit more cables in the same space, saving you the time and cost of expanding or replacing cable pathways.High Performance: This cable is perfect for 10-Gigabit Ethernet and is backwards compatible with any existing Fast Ethernet and Gigabit Ethernet.Thinner and Lighter: SlimRun Cat6A is much lighter…
